Pianist Judy Lin, returning from a year in Singapore, has programmed her favorite chamber works from the Bakken Trio repertoire in a program called "Reflections on ghosts and tides: an aural scrapbook". Beethoven's "Ghost Trio" and Takemitsu's "Between Tides", both of which the Bakken Trio recorded on CD, balance the Dvorak Piano Quartet in E flat major. Former Bakken cellist Katja Linfield and violist Ken Freed join violinist Stephanie Arado and pianist Judy Lin to celebrate the favorites of their past.
The Bakken Trio has a 30-year long history of performing great chamber music in the Twin Cities, first as the Bakken Quartet at the Bakken Museum of Electricity and currently performing at MacPhail Center for Music. Winners of the McKnight Fellowship for Artists, they have received awards from the Composers Forum as well. Their two CD’s are available at Barnes and Noble and Cheapo.
